All rights reserved. # SPDX-License-Identifier: OpenMDW-1.1 # Runtime load tracer. # # Auto-imported by every Python process started with PYTHONPATH=. # When LOAD_TRACE_DIR is set, registers an atexit hook that walks # sys.modules at shutdown and writes the file paths (filtered to those # under LOAD_TRACE_ROOT) into {LOAD_TRACE_DIR}/{LOAD_TRACE_TAG}_pid{PID}.txt. # # Used to inventory which released files are actually touched by each # end-to-end smoke. Union the per-experiment traces, diff against the full # .py list, and the residual is dead code (relative to that smoke set). import atexit import os import sys _DIR = os.environ.get("LOAD_TRACE_DIR", "") if _DIR: _TAG = os.environ.get("LOAD_TRACE_TAG", "default") _ROOT = os.path.realpath(os.environ.get("LOAD_TRACE_ROOT", os.getcwd())) os.makedirs(_DIR, exist_ok=True) def _dump(): seen = set() for mod in list(sys.modules.values()): f = getattr(mod, "__file__", None) if not f: continue try: rp = os.path.realpath(f) except OSError: continue if rp.startswith(_ROOT): seen.add(rp) path = os.path.join(_DIR, f"{_TAG}_pid{os.getpid()}.txt") try: with open(path, "w") as h: for p in sorted(seen): h.write(p + "\n") except OSError: pass atexit.register(_dump)
